Hi guys

Just an update on ours.

We had an issue with our tiles this week. The main floor tiles we originally chose aren’t arriving til June and the colours were apparently also arriving in different shades so i had to reselect asap.

I ended up upgrading to 600x600 porcelain instead of the 450x450 ceramic. Unfortunately we won’t be able to have screeding as it’s too far into the build so only wet areas are screeded and the main flooring will be glued on.

Our build has been moving incredibly fast, I’m quite shocked cause i was expecting it to be a lengthy build going by previous threads.

We’ve had our kitchen/laundry/vanity installed, waterproofing, doors and ac/electrical cutouts completed.

I think we’re tiling next week!
